Snow Removal from Private Residences and businesses

The Maplewood Police Department would like to remind it's residents of the following township ordinances in reference to snow removal. Those that violate these ordinances may be issued summons. Please make sure that they are followed to help keep everyone safe.

§ 239-1
Removal from sidewalks required.

The owner, occupant or tenant of premises abutting or bordering on any street in the Township of Maplewood shall remove all snow and ice from the abutting sidewalks of such street or the abutting right-of-way actually used by the public within 24 hours from the end of every snowfall or hail or after the formation of ice upon the sidewalks or abutting right-of-way. In the event of ice which may be so frozen as to make removal impractical, the ice shall be thoroughly covered with sand or salt within 24 hours from the end of every fall of snow, or hail, or after the formation of ice upon the sidewalks or abutting right-of-way so as to protect against falls.

§ 239-2
Deposit in plowed streets unlawful.

No owner or tenant of any lands abutting upon any public highway of this municipality or agent, employee, servant or contractor of such owner or tenant or person shall throw, place, plow or deposit any snow or ice into or upon any traveled area of the street or road that has already been plowed.
